タグ

ブックマーク / coriandre.seesaa.net (2)

  • AndroidでのBLEに関して

    さきほど書いたiOSと違って、AndroidでのBLE対応に関しては、かなり限定的で資料も乏しい状況です。 新Nexus7でSDKのBLEサンプルを動かしてみた https://coriandre.seesaa.net/article/201308article_1.html で書いたようにAndroid4.3(API18)からBLEをネイティブ対応したので、Nexus7(2013)であればSDKを使ってBLE対応の開発が可能です。 ただ、まだ調査中なのですが、SDKのAPIはCentralのみでPeripheralのためのAPIがなさそうです。 事前のGoogleの発表だとAndroid端末間でBLEを使用しての通信は出来ないとのことです。 そのため対向として、ブルタグのような機器か、iPhoneのBTLE Central Peripheral Transferのようなものが必要になるか

    AndroidでのBLEに関して
  • iOSでのBLEに関して

    BLE関連の仕事してるので調べたことをまとめておきます。 BLEはiOSの場合、iPhone4S以降であれば、CoreBluetoothを使用して実装ができます。 そのためか、資料、サンプルともに豊富です。 CoreBluetoothについては以下のレファレンスを参照して下さい。 http://developer.apple.com/library/ios/documentation/CoreBluetooth/Reference/CoreBluetooth_Framework/_index.html ●資料、ノウハウ等 1、 iOSアプリ開発者のための Bluetooth Low Energy体験講座 http://www.slideshare.net/reinforcelab/20130322-btle 上原昭宏さんによる講座の資料、非常にためになります。 Bluetoot Low E

  • 1